From: Li RongQing @ 2024-06-19  2:55 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: mst, jasowang, xuanzhuo, eperezma, hengqi, virtualization, netdev
  Cc: Li RongQing

This place is fetching the stats, so u64_stats_fetch_begin
and u64_stats_fetch_retry should be used

Fixes: 6208799553a8 ("virtio-net: support rx netdim")
Signed-off-by: Li RongQing <lirongqing@baidu.com>
---
 drivers/net/virtio_net.c | 14 ++++++++------
 1 file changed, 8 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/net/virtio_net.c b/drivers/net/virtio_net.c
index 61a57d1..b669e73 100644
--- a/drivers/net/virtio_net.c
+++ b/drivers/net/virtio_net.c
@@ -2332,16 +2332,18 @@ static void virtnet_poll_cleantx(struct receive_queue *rq)
 static void virtnet_rx_dim_update(struct virtnet_info *vi, struct receive_queue *rq)
 {
 	struct dim_sample cur_sample = {};
+	unsigned int start;
 
 	if (!rq->packets_in_napi)
 		return;
 
-	u64_stats_update_begin(&rq->stats.syncp);
-	dim_update_sample(rq->calls,
-			  u64_stats_read(&rq->stats.packets),
-			  u64_stats_read(&rq->stats.bytes),
-			  &cur_sample);
-	u64_stats_update_end(&rq->stats.syncp);
+	do {
+		start = u64_stats_fetch_begin(&rq->stats.syncp);
+		dim_update_sample(rq->calls,
+				u64_stats_read(&rq->stats.packets),
+				u64_stats_read(&rq->stats.bytes),
+				&cur_sample);
+	} while (u64_stats_fetch_retry(&rq->stats.syncp, start));
 
 	net_dim(&rq->dim, cur_sample);
 	rq->packets_in_napi = 0;

From: Jakub Kicinski @ 2024-06-20 14:09 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: Li RongQing
  Cc: mst, jasowang, xuanzhuo, eperezma, hengqi, virtualization, netdev

On Wed, 19 Jun 2024 10:55:29 +0800 Li RongQing wrote:
> This place is fetching the stats, so u64_stats_fetch_begin
> and u64_stats_fetch_retry should be used
> 
> Fixes: 6208799553a8 ("virtio-net: support rx netdim")
> Signed-off-by: Li RongQing <lirongqing@baidu.com>
> ---
>  drivers/net/virtio_net.c | 14 ++++++++------
>  1 file changed, 8 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)
> 
> diff --git a/drivers/net/virtio_net.c b/drivers/net/virtio_net.c
> index 61a57d1..b669e73 100644
> --- a/drivers/net/virtio_net.c
> +++ b/drivers/net/virtio_net.c
> @@ -2332,16 +2332,18 @@ static void virtnet_poll_cleantx(struct receive_queue *rq)
>  static void virtnet_rx_dim_update(struct virtnet_info *vi, struct receive_queue *rq)
>  {
>  	struct dim_sample cur_sample = {};
> +	unsigned int start;
>  
>  	if (!rq->packets_in_napi)
>  		return;
>  
> -	u64_stats_update_begin(&rq->stats.syncp);
> -	dim_update_sample(rq->calls,
> -			  u64_stats_read(&rq->stats.packets),
> -			  u64_stats_read(&rq->stats.bytes),
> -			  &cur_sample);
> -	u64_stats_update_end(&rq->stats.syncp);
> +	do {
> +		start = u64_stats_fetch_begin(&rq->stats.syncp);
> +		dim_update_sample(rq->calls,
> +				u64_stats_read(&rq->stats.packets),
> +				u64_stats_read(&rq->stats.bytes),
> +				&cur_sample);
> +	} while (u64_stats_fetch_retry(&rq->stats.syncp, start));

Did you by any chance use an automated tool of any sort to find this
issue or generate the fix?

I don't think this is actually necessary here, you're in the same
context as the updater of the stats, you don't need any protection.
You can remove u64_stats_update_begin() / end() (in net-next, there's
no bug).

I won't comment on implications of calling dim_update_sample() in 
a loop.

Please make sure you answer my "did you use a tool" question, I'm
really curious.
